    Corrupted Windows partition Table


    Hello Sir,

    First of all,to inform you, this has happened due to my mistake! and i am really very guilty about it.

    The thing is that i have both ubuntu 12.04 and win 7 home basic installed on my system.
    I installed ubuntu later so as expected the win7 loader was replaced by the grub loader.
    What i wanted to do was restore my original win7 loader so that i could set my default OS to Win7 so that i didn't have to select it every time my system booted up.

    In this regard,i searched some youtube videos and then ended up with a video which was not described very well, still i followed it because i wanted to get back the win7 loader desperately.
    I am providing the link to that video:

    Restoring Windows's Bootloader After Installing Linux - YouTube

    I went ahead with the steps described in the video, And then shit happened.
    My windows partition got corrupted and now i stand at the risk of losing about 500gb of important data which i had collected in about over an year.

    I am able to boot using ubuntu but i am unable to browse my files on the hard disk(which i could do easily, earlier) as it doesn't show any partition.

    When i inserted the recovery disc,it simply gives the option of restoring the factory settings,nothing else(like repair,which it used to give earlier).

    My question to you sir, is that, is there any way through which i can restore my computer to normal and save my data?

    Just fyi, once you get this fixed there is a setting from within Ubuntu to choose the default OS. You can set Windows to be automatically selected when you boot and also set the length of time the OS choice menu is presented. Replacing GRUB is not the way to do this.

    What do you mean your partition got corrupted. Is it still a partition, or is it labeled RAW, Unallocated or Free Space when you boot the PW disk?

    If it's an intact partition, mark it Active in PW, then boot into WIn7 DVD or REpair CD to run Startup Repair - Run up to 3 Separate Times.

    This is how you recover Win7 from having GRUB boot loader imposed upon it.

    If the partition is missing then run the Partition Recovery Wizard to attempt to undelete it, then mark Active and run the Repairs. If you don't mark Active and run the Repairs it will not start no matter what else you do.
